电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

单片机定时器50ms

2023-10-10 11:57分类:电工基础知识 阅读:

 

单片机定时器是单片机中的一个重要模块,用于实现定时功能。定时器50ms是指定时器每隔50毫秒触发一次中断。在单片机应用中,定时器50ms具有多个重要的应用方面。

定时器50ms可以用于控制系统的时序。在许多实时控制系统中,需要按照一定的时间间隔执行某些操作,例如采样、数据处理等。定时器50ms可以提供一个精确的时间基准,通过定时器中断触发,可以在每隔50ms执行一次相应的操作,从而保证系统的时序。

定时器50ms可以用于实现延时功能。在一些需要延时执行的场景中,定时器50ms可以提供一个简单而有效的延时方式。通过设置定时器的计数值和中断触发时间,可以实现精确的延时功能。例如,可以使用定时器50ms实现按键消抖功能,在按键按下后延时一段时间再进行处理,避免误触发。

定时器50ms还可以用于定时检测外部事件。在一些需要周期性检测外部事件的应用中,定时器50ms可以提供一个定时触发的机制。通过定时器中断触发,可以周期性地检测外部事件的状态,例如检测传感器的数据、检测通信接口的状态等。

定时器50ms还可以用于实现定时任务的调度。在一些多任务系统中,需要按照一定的时间间隔调度不同的任务执行。定时器50ms可以作为一个时间片,通过定时中断触发,可以实现简单的任务调度功能。例如,可以将不同的任务按照优先级划分,通过定时器50ms按照一定的顺序调度执行。

单片机定时器50ms在实际应用中具有重要的作用。它可以用于控制系统的时序、实现延时功能、定时检测外部事件以及定时任务的调度。通过合理的使用定时器50ms,可以提高系统的稳定性和可靠性,实现更多的功能。

上一篇:单片机定义及其应用

下一篇:单片机定义字符

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部